Career Pathways for Changers

We support transitions into high-demand sectors where your existing skills can be valuable assets.

Transport & Rail

Bus drivers, train operators, station staff, and operational roles. Customer service skills are highly transferable. Competitive pay, structured shifts, and clear progression.

Mechanical & Engineering

Maintenance technicians, fleet support, diagnostics, and technical roles. Problem-solving and analytical skills from previous careers are valuable here.

Construction

Site management, trades, project coordination, and health & safety roles. Organizational and leadership skills are in high demand across the construction sector.

Care & Support

Adult care, child care, support work, and healthcare assistance. Empathy, communication, and people skills make career changers excellent in care roles.
